Attributes of Yorkshire Terrier Puppies
Yorkshire Terrier puppies are small however magnificent. Their unique characteristics set them apart from other types:
| Characteristic | Description |
|---|---|
| Size | Normally weigh between 4 to 7 pounds when fully grown |
| Height | Stand about 7 to 8 inches high at the shoulder |
| Coat | Long, silky hair that is typically blue and tan |
| Life expectancy | Generally live in between 12 to 15 years |
| Energy Level | High-energy, requiring regular workout and mental stimulation |
| Temperament | Caring, dynamic, and smart |

Nutrition
Due to their small size, Yorkies have unique dietary requirements. Here's an easy standard:
| Age | Food Type | Feeding Frequency |
|---|---|---|
| 8 weeks to 6 months | High-quality puppy food (dry kibble) | 3-4 times each day |
| 6 months to 1 year | Healthy puppy or small-breed adult food | 2-3 times daily |
| Over 1 year | Premium small-breed adult food | 2 times daily |
Grooming
Yorkies' long, stunning coats require routine grooming:
- Brushing: Brush their hair daily to avoid mats and tangles.
- Bathing: Bathe them every 3-4 weeks utilizing dog-specific hair shampoo.
- Cutting: Regular trips to the groomer can assist preserve their coat shape and handle stray hairs.
Exercise
Yorkshire Terriers are energetic little dogs that need day-to-day workout:
- Daily Walks: Aim for a minimum of 30 minutes of active play or walks.
- Interactive Play: Engage them with toys that promote imagination, like puzzle toys or Mini Yorkie Puppies bring video games.
Health Care
Routine veterinary gos to are vital to ensure your puppy stays healthy:
- Vaccinations: Keep updated with vaccinations to prevent major diseases.
- Dental Health: Establish a routine dental care routine, including brushing their teeth.
- Parasite Control: Use preventative treatments for fleas, ticks, and worms.
Training and Socialization
Early training and socializing are necessary for Yorkshire Terrier puppies. Here are some tips:
- Start Early: Begin training as quickly as you bring your puppy home. Puppies are most receptive to learning in between 8-12 weeks.
- Use Positive Reinforcement: Reward-based training works finest. Deal deals with and applaud for great behavior.
- Socialization: Expose your puppy to different environments, individuals, and other animals. This will assist avoid behavioral problems later in life.
Essential Commands to Teach:
- Sit: Foundation for good habits.
- Stay: Helps with impulse control.
- Come: Essential for security.
- Leave It: Prevents chewing or eating damaging products.
